The film follows (played by Soham Chakraborty), a lower-middle-class youth who harbors intense ambitions of becoming a champion singer. He is a habitual dreamer and prankster who struggles academically. Subhro falls in love with Jhilik (played by Subhashree Ganguly), a wealthy, talented girl who shares the exact same musical aspirations.

Released during a transitional era for Tollywood, Bazzimaat is a prime example of the late-2000s commercial formula that blended family melodrama, musical competition, and intense action sequences. It arrived at a time when television reality talent shows were exploding in real-world popularity across India, making its narrative highly relatable to contemporary audiences.
